Class CosmosConflictRequestOptions


  • public final class CosmosConflictRequestOptions
    extends Object
    The type Cosmos conflict request options.
    • Constructor Detail

      • CosmosConflictRequestOptions

        public CosmosConflictRequestOptions​(PartitionKey partitionKey)
        Creates a new CosmosConflictRequestOptions object.
        Parameters:
        partitionKey - the partitionKey associated with the request.
    • Method Detail

      • getIfMatchETag

        public String getIfMatchETag()
        Gets the If-Match (ETag) associated with the request in the Azure Cosmos DB service.
        Returns:
        ifMatchETag the ifMatchETag associated with the request.
      • setIfMatchETag

        public CosmosConflictRequestOptions setIfMatchETag​(String ifMatchETag)
        Sets the If-Match (ETag) associated with the request in the Azure Cosmos DB service.
        Parameters:
        ifMatchETag - the ifMatchETag associated with the request.
        Returns:
        the current request options
      • getIfNoneMatchETag

        public String getIfNoneMatchETag()
        Gets the If-None-Match (ETag) associated with the request in the Azure Cosmos DB service.
        Returns:
        the ifNoneMatchETag associated with the request.
      • setIfNoneMatchETag

        public CosmosConflictRequestOptions setIfNoneMatchETag​(String ifNoneMatchEtag)
        Sets the If-None-Match (ETag) associated with the request in the Azure Cosmos DB service.
        Parameters:
        ifNoneMatchEtag - the ifNoneMatchETag associated with the request.
        Returns:
        the current request options
      • setPartitionKey

        public CosmosConflictRequestOptions setPartitionKey​(PartitionKey partitionKey)
        Sets the partition key associated with the request in the Azure Cosmos DB service.
        Parameters:
        partitionKey - the partition key associated with the request.
        Returns:
        the CosmosItemRequestOptions.
      • getPartitionKey

        public PartitionKey getPartitionKey()
        Gets the partition key associated with the request in the Azure Cosmos DB service.
        Returns:
        the partitionKey associated with the request.